Handover note — Crumbwheel order cutoffs.

Welcome aboard. The bakery cutoff rule in Crumbwheel closes same-day orders at 14:00 local to each storefront, not UTC — this has bitten us twice. Holiday overrides live in the calendar service and take precedence silently, so always check there first when a cutoff looks wrong. To unlock the calendar service's admin console after a restart, enter the recovery passphrase below.

vault phrase of bagap-bahaf = silion-pelox-sorox-casdor-quenwyn-fraax-eliox-praael-kelion-quenvan-kasox-rusael-norius-belvan

**FAQ: How do I regain admin access to the Binwise pick-list optimizer?**

Good question — reviewers hit this a lot. Binwise locks the optimizer console after thirty days of admin inactivity, which is intentional, not a bug. Routing still runs; only tuning is frozen. Don't reset the service account. Instead, at the unlock prompt, enter the recovery passphrase shown below.

recovery phrase for bawep-kawef: oliath-casdor

The scheduler computes intervals from sensor moisture deltas, so verify that any change to the interpolation logic includes updated fixture data under tests/soil_profiles. Pay particular attention to timezone handling: schedules are stored in UTC but rendered in greenhouse-local time. To authenticate the harness against Mistwell's internal forecast service, export the credential into your shell before running make verify. The forecast service key appears below.

app token of kawif-yafop = zpat2_88

**SQL Lint Failures in Quarrelsome CI**

If your merge request fails the `sqlcheck` stage, the linter at Fennwick Labs enforces uppercase keywords, explicit column lists, and no trailing semicolons in migration files. Run `quarrel lint --sql` locally before pushing. Most violations auto-fix with the `--repair` flag. Rules live in `lint/sql-rules.yaml`; don't edit them without a review from the data platform team. To fetch the rules bundle from the config service, authenticate with the token below.

portal login ticket: eyJhbGciOiJIUzI1NiIsInR5cCI6IkpXVCJ9.eyJzdWIiOiIwEOsktwVNwIn0.-UJU3fdyyCgG